At Maple Leaf Sports & Entertainment Partnership (MLSE), we are committed to creating an inclusive workplace that is representative of our community and where all employees feel they belong and can reach their full potential. We are Canada’s preeminent leader in delivering top quality sport and entertainment experiences and one of North America’s leading providers of exceptional fan experiences. We are the parent company of the National Hockey League’s Toronto Maple Leafs, the National Basketball Association’s Toronto Raptors, Major League Soccer’s Toronto FC, the Canadian Football League’s Toronto Argonauts and development teams with the Toronto Marlies (American Hockey League), Raptors 905 (NBA G League), Toronto FC II (MLS NEXT Pro League) and Raptors Uprising Gaming Club, the Toronto Raptors Esports franchise in the NBA 2K League.


MLSE owns and/or operates all the venues our teams play and train in, including Scotiabank Arena, BMO Field, Coca-Cola Coliseum, Ford Performance Centre, BMO Training Ground, and OVO Athletic Centre. We also provide fans in Toronto with incredible live music and entertainment events, as well as exceptional culinary experiences through our restaurants (e11even and RS) and clubs (Hot Stove Club, ScotiaClub and Platinum Club). Through MLSE Foundation, we have invested more than $45 million into Ontario communities since 2009 and with MLSE LaunchPad, we provide a place where youth facing barriers use sport to recognize and reach their potential.

The Digital Content Department oversees all owned team channels (social channels for Raptors/Toronto FC/Leafs/Argos). Working alongside our Brand team, the digital team leads the social voice of our teams, speaking to millions every day. We strive to deliver content with a purpose, formatted for each channel, and continually optimized. We seek opportunities to grow our fan base and find new and innovative ways to distribute our content.


This role reports directly to the Director, Strategy & Growth Marketing (Red Vertical – Raptors/Toronto FC) and is passionate about crafting a story across all our digital touchpoints. They will be a people manager and understand how to lead and inspire a team and promote career growth across their direct reports. They will manage the social media team and work together to bring our brand to life for fans through a multi-medium approach. They are constantly thinking of new ways to engage fans and help deliver against MLSE’s business objectives. The right candidate lives and breathes the social cultural trends and sees opportunity in how our brands can join the conversation. You'll partner with the other members of the Digital Content team, both in a direct and indirect reporting structure, to bring our work to the next level.


This is not your typical 9-5 job. You are a major part of our storytelling that occurs on game days, supporting the larger digital content team depending on the workload and where the team(s) are at in their seasons.


Responsibilities:


  • Oversee the planning of Social Media content (including posts, videos, reels, and copy) that intrigues our existing audience, and appeals to our growth segments
  • Support and grow our commercial business, driving strong collaboration between Social and Global Partnerships teams
  • Build strong relationships and collaborate with key stakeholders including Team Front Offices, Media Relations, Public Relations, Brand, Partnerships
  • Work collaboratively and closely with broader Content team on season-long objectives, production efficiencies, working to uplift a cohesive approach across all content touchpoints
  • Lead the team in identifying and leaning into emerging platform opportunities and culturally-driven moments, looking to unlock growth for MLSE teams, and our partners
  • Lead the creation of social strategies for the overall season, campaigns, and team calendar moments that elevates the team and drives the brand ambition forward
  • Lead the team in Social Media analytics and insights, reporting on success regularly, plus bring the ability to identify and action pivots or opportunities forward to key stakeholders
  • Lead the team that runs our Social Media channels including Tik Tok, Instagram, Facebook, Twitter
  • Build and drive forward a point of view on all our digital channels (social, emails, app, website), with a keen focus on emerging channels
  • Author and uphold a social media strategy (inclusive of a channel strategy) that establishes a framework and process with MLSE stakeholder groups that rely deeply on social for business success – Brand, Global Partnerships, Culture, Ticketing, Retail
